Used to run 10 miles in the morning and 10 in the evening, Because the Senior Distance
Runner did that, I was a Sophomore when I started. He was First, I was second. Then He graduated. 1 year I trained at 8000 ft elevation.
Run Distance.
Run Sprints.
Run Up and down hills and Stairs(Stadiums are great)
Run Backwards.
I liked to breathe IN IN OUT OUT IN IN For every step, It became Automatic, almost hypnotic.
IT is easier to stay in bed and sleep late.
It is tough, you will have more energy to do more of everything.
If you like hiking or exploring, Running can allow you to cover more area in less time,
And makes it more fun.
Keep Hydrated and Stretch, Cool down, walk it off.
Your body will run more efficient
Won't sweat as easy.
Breathing and Heart Rate resumes quickly.

I, too, ran twice a day in high school.

But what really made me improve (19's to high 17's) was hills and fartleks.

Don't know if 17s will get you to state or not. Obviously I was not the world's best, but was a good improver.
